The DSEG810 is a 10” capacitive touchscreen DSE SCADA overview display designed for monitoring and controlling multiple applications. It runs on the reliable LINUX based operating system and is designed for use with the DSEG8-Series paralleling controller platform. When installed, the unit offers IP67 protection all round, and the powerful NXP i.MX 8 QuadXPlus processor ensures smooth operation. The unit is connected to DSEG8-Series controllers via Ethernet.

Software
DSE SCADA is a secure software platform that provides advanced multi-set monitoring & commissioning functionality for DSEG8-Series controllers. The stand-alone software is pre-loaded onto each device, which includes a full software license. The software can be configured to connect with individual / multiple generators on the same site. Users can gain a full system overview from any remote location with an Internet connection. The software provides multi-set commissioning.
PLEASE NOTE: The DSEG810 requires the panel mount kit (100-413-01) found in related products in order to be mounted.

Specification

DC Supply

Continuous Voltage Rating
8 V to 32 V DC continuous

Maximum Operating Current
< 1500 mA at 12 V and 24 V without external loads

Display

Display
10.1” TFT
1280 x 800 resolution 24 bit colour
Optically bonded

Brightness
1000 cd/m2 (nit)

Processor

iMX8QuadXPlus Microcontroller
4 x ARM Cortex A35

Outputs

Audio Output
1 x Mono Single Channel

Communications

USB
Used to Connect External Mouse / Keyboard

Ethernet
1 x 10 Mbits/s / 100 Mbits/s Ethernet Port

Temperature

Operating Temperature
-30 °C to +65 °C / -22 °F to +149 °F
Storage Temperature
-30 °C to +80 °C / -40 °F to +176 °F

Dimensions

Overall (W x H x D)
281 mm x 181 mm x 61.5 mm / 11.0 ” x 7.12 ” x 2.42 ”

Weight
1.76 kg / 3.88 lb

Mounting

Type
Panel Fascia Mounting

Panel Cut-Out (W x H)
265 mm x 165 mm (R 12 mm) / 10.2 ” x 6.5 ” (R 0.5 “)

Maximum Panel Thickness
6 mm / 0.2 ”
